| After 2 months of self-study, I just passed the CCDA exam scored closed to 900.
The resources used were Cisco Press 2 books: CCDA Certification Guide and Designing Cisco
Networks (DCN). I found the DCN book more readable. Unlike M$ exams. even though you
studied M$ Press books from back to front
ten times, you may still fail the exam. I
think Cisco is more fair to the students, all
the answers to the exam questions can be found in the Cisco Press books.
Just beware that once you answered a question and clicked NEXT, you can't go back to change your answer.
